Are full time instrumentation field engineers in demand?

Full-time instrumentation field engineers are in demand due to the ongoing need for maintenance, calibration, and installation of control systems in industries such as manufacturing, oil and gas, and utilities. Employment opportunities often require technical skills, certifications, and experience working with tools like PLCs and SCADA systems, and demand can vary based on industry growth and regional infrastructure projects.

What is the difference between Full Time Instrumentation Field Engineer vs Maintenance Technician?

AspectFull Time Instrumentation Field EngineerMaintenance Technician
CertificationsInstrumentation certifications, such as ISA certificationsGeneral maintenance or technical certifications
Work EnvironmentIndustrial sites, oil & gas, manufacturing plantsFactories, plants, equipment repair facilities
Job FocusInstallation, calibration, troubleshooting of instrumentation systemsPreventive maintenance, repairs, equipment servicing
Employer & Industry UsageOil & gas, petrochemical, manufacturingVarious manufacturing and industrial sectors

Full Time Instrumentation Field Engineers primarily focus on installing, calibrating, and troubleshooting instrumentation systems in industrial environments, requiring specialized certifications. Maintenance Technicians handle routine repairs and preventive maintenance across various industries. While both roles work in industrial settings, the Engineer role emphasizes system setup and diagnostics, whereas the Technician focuses on equipment upkeep.

Job Summary
In this role, you will support successful field execution on a combined cycle power generation construction project by providing contractors with the technical guidance, contract information, and direction needed to keep work moving safely, efficiently, and on schedule. You will help interpret design drawings and specifications, resolve field questions, and partner with site leadership to support quality, safety, planning, and construction progress across major power island and balance-of-plant scopes. This is a field assignment located in Corpus Chisti, Texas.
#LI-KC1 #fieldengineer #construction #combinedcycle
Key Responsibilities
As a Structural Field Engineer supporting combined cycle construction, you will play an important role in helping field teams execute complex power generation work across civil, structural, mechanical, piping, electrical, instrumentation, and balance-of-plant scopes. Responsibilities include:
  • Provide technical guidance and interpretation of design drawings, specifications, and overall combined cycle project requirements to subcontractors and craft teams.
  • Partner with contractors and site leadership to help resolve issues related to combined cycle design information, schedule, material deliveries, quality, and safety.
  • Review, track, and respond to Requests for Information (RFIs) while maintaining accurate supporting records.
  • Support field execution for combined cycle systems and equipment, which may include combustion turbine generators, heat recovery steam generators, steam turbine generators, auxiliary equipment, piping systems, electrical systems, instrumentation and controls, and balance-of-plant facilities.
  • Maintain daily site logs and documentation to support project records and reporting.
  • Review engineered quantities and assist the Discipline Superintendent with installed quantity reviews to support planning and progress tracking.
  • Coordinate with engineering, construction, quality, materials, and commissioning teams to support safe installation, turnover readiness, and resolution of field constraints on combined cycle scopes.
  • Support site document control activities to help ensure teams are working from current and accurate design documents.
  • Compile and maintain conformed-to-construction records, drawing markups, and related documentation in coordination with document control staff as needed.
  • Assist the Field Quality Manager with inspections, test verification, and quality-related field activities.
  • Promote and follow safety and quality standards appropriate to the role's responsibilities and level of accountability.
